#345343 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#345343 is composed of 20.4% red, 32.5%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.3%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 149 degrees, a saturation of 23% and a lightness of 26.5%. #345343 color hex could be obtained by blending #68a686 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#345343

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b09 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#345343

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e4943 is the less saturated color, while #008741 is the most saturated one.
